An 11-Year Old Girl Was Killed By Her Mother's Live-In Partner: An Example of a Parricide Crime?

Image
As reported in ABS-CBN news webpage on November 6, 2014, an 11-year old girl was shot and killed by her mother's live-in partner in Asingan, Pangasinan. Is this an example of a parricide crime? According to Article 246 of the Revised Penal Code, a parricide is committed by any person who shall kill his father, mother, or child, whether legitimate or illegitimate, or any of his ascendants, or descendants, or his spouse, and shall be punished by the penalty of reclusion perpetua to death. In the news reported by ABS-CBN, who was killed by the alleged actor was the child of his live-in partner.  Said child was not the alleged killer's child. Hence, no parricide was committed. If not parricide, what crime did the allegd killer has committed? Generally, the crime committed allegedly was homicide.  However it may be qualified into murder considering the disparity of strength, that may be explained in the age and gender differences, between the alleged killer and the victim. A Father Who Slashed the Throat of his Daughter: His Liability

Image
This is a page created by netizens in seeking justice for the slain daughter.  Image was taken from the page of ABS-CBNnews.com. This is the news that shattered the whole nation this week.  A father slashed the throat of his very own daughter and then he even posted the picture of his dead daughter to his Facebook account.  Accordingly, he (the father) had an earlier altercation with his wife over the internet that led to the brutal death of their child.  The wife is working abroad.  You may read the whole story at ABS-CBNnews.com. In this situation, the crime that the father is charged of is PARRICIDE.  It is parricide because of the relationship of the offender to the victim.
